Block 76,678
Block Hash
de5fc247f1888a5fb7d9c6b70ba52d17f4aef50449b0d15c6f540522b9
cffbd1
Previous Block Hash
58c1ea54335598431e835f1c33b5f1215f561ed7559d398c982a2ca3fb 54e3cb
Mined
Transactions
1
Difficulty
1.40 M
Size
172 bytes
Transactions (1)
1 input, 1 output
500,000.00
PEPE